Pick Games That Give You a Fighting Chance

Not all slot or table games are created equal. Some eat your cash faster than others. If you’re depositing with a credit card, you want games with high RTP (Return to Player). Look for slots around 96% and above. Blackjack variants can go over 99% if you play basic strategy.

What to look for in game selection:

  • Slots with RTP of 96% or higher — check the info screen
  • Blackjack with 3:2 blackjack payout, not 6:5
  • Baccarat betting on banker — lowest house edge
  • Video poker like Jacks or Better with full-pay tables
  • Roulette with European wheel (single zero cuts house edge in half)

Avoid games like keno, side bets, or slots with massive jackpots but terrible base payouts. The house always has an edge, but you can shrink it way down.

Hunt for Bonuses With Fair Wagering

Bonuses at credit card casinos can boost your bankroll, but not all are worth taking. A 100% match up to £500 sounds great until you see 50x wagering requirements. That means you’d need to bet £25,000 before withdrawing any winnings from the bonus. Hard pass.

What to look for in a good bonus:
– Wagering requirements at or below 30x
– Games like slots contribute 100% to wagering
– No max cashout or a reasonable cap like 10x the bonus
– Offer codes that apply to credit card deposits specifically

Manage Your Bankroll Like a Pro

Bankroll management separates casual players from consistent winners. Decide ahead of time how much you’re willing to lose that session — never more than you can afford to lose. A simple rule: bet no more than 1-2% of your total bankroll per spin or hand.

If you deposit £200 with your credit card, that means max bets of £2 to £4. That might not seem exciting, but it keeps you in the game longer. When you win, consider locking away half the profit into a separate balance or cashing out. Don’t let a hot streak turn into a cold one because you kept playing.
